fork download
  1. (define (make-rat n d)
  2. (let ((g (gcd n d)))
  3. (cons (/ (*
  4. (abs n)
  5. (if (xnor (> n 0)
  6. (> d 0))
  7. 1
  8. -1))
  9. g)
  10. (/ (abs d) g))))
Runtime error #stdin #stdout #stderr 0s 4496KB
stdin
Standard input is empty
stdout
Standard output is empty
stderr
Wrong __data_start/_end pair